Manchester United 'working on January deal for Cody Gakpo'

Manchester United could reportedly sign Dutch attacker Cody Gakpo from PSV Eindhoven during the January transfer window.

Cody Gakpo could reportedly leave PSV Eindhoven during the January transfer window, with Manchester United firmly interested in his signature.

The 23-year-old held talks with the Red Devils over the summer, but he ultimately remained with Eindhoven past the transfer deadline.

Gakpo has been in excellent form for his Dutch club this season, scoring nine goals and registering 12 assists in 14 Eredivisie appearances, while he netted three times and provided two assists in five outings in the group stage of the Europa League.

The speculation surrounding the forward's future has gathered pace due to his performances at the 2022 World Cup, as he has scored three times in three appearances for the Netherlands, who have advanced to the last-16 stage of the competition.

Man United are likely to be in the market for a new forward in January due to Cristiano Ronaldo's recent departure, and Gakpo is being strongly linked with a move to Old Trafford.

According to Italian journalist Fabrizio Romano, Gakpo could be allowed to leave PSV in January despite his importance to the Dutch giants.

"There are chances for Cody Gakpo to leave PSV already in January. Original plan was to sell him in the summer but could change after excellent World Cup," Romano wrote on his official Twitter account.

Meanwhile, the Italian journalist added that Man United remain "in contact" with the forward's agents, and the club are planning to hold fresh talks in the near future.

"He is doing absolutely fantastic in the World Cup, he has scored in every game. His numbers with PSV were already great, because he is scoring goals and providing assists. This player is special," Romano said on his YouTube channel.

"Manchester United are still in contact with the agents of Cody Gakpo, they have new contacts planned to have new discussions.

"The relationship is fantastic, the agents of Gakpo are the same agents of [manager] Erik ten Hag. They are working hard on this. Manchester United will have to decide on the price as in the summer PSV were demanding £43m and after the World Cup it will be higher."

Gakpo has scored 55 goals and registered 50 assists in 159 appearances for PSV in all competitions, while he now has five goals in 11 outings for his country.

Man United had initially been expected to wait until next summer to bring in a new forward, but Ronaldo's recent departure could force them into the January market, as their options in the final third of the field are now limited.
